What kind of Special Education is Available?

In India, most prominently available for


• Persons with disabilities.
Persons with disabilities include Persons with
• Autism,
• Blindness & Low vision
• Cerebral palsy,
• Deafness,
• Loco-motor and neurological disorder
• Learning disability
• Mental retardation, and
• Multiple disabilities.
Career in Special Education
• Career programs are available in the form of
• M.Ed. Special Education
• B. Ed. Special Education
• D. Ed. Special Education
• Master  in Audiology and Speech-Language Pathology
• M.Sc. in Audiology 
• M.Sc. in Speech Language Pathology
• Diploma in Hearing Language and Speech
• Bachelor in Audiology and Speech-Language Pathology
Career in Special Education
contd….

• M.Phil (Rehabilitation Psychology)


• M.Phil (Clinical Psychology)
• P.G. Diploma in Rehabilitation Psychology
• Master in Prosthetics & Orthotics
• Bachelor in Prosthetics and Orthotics
• Diploma in Prosthetics and Orthotics
• Ph. D in disability studies.
Besides the above programs
• There are certificate courses for parents and others
Who is Eligible?
A Plus to (+2) pass either in Science or Arts for
• Diploma and Bachelor degree programs
Qualifying in An Entrance Test conducted by
• Rehabilitation Council of India for diploma programs
• University concerned for Bachelor & Master degrees

Where are the Spl. Edn programs available?
• Programs in Special Education are available under:
• IGNOU,
• Indraprastha University,
• University of Bombay, Mumbai
• SNDT, Mumbai
• Maharastra University of Health Sciences, Nasik
• Osmania University
• West Bengal University of Health Sciences,
• Benaras Hindu University,
• Utkal University,
• Berhampur University.
Available at:
NIOH, NIMH, NIVH, NIEPMD, NIRTAR, AIIPMR, IPH, AIISH,
AYJNIHH, Mumbai and its R.Cs at Kolkata, Secunderabad, New Delhi, and Bhubaneswar.
And at many Institutes of Special Education & Rehabilitation managed by NGOs but
recognized by RCI, New Delhi. For details please visit www.rehabcouncil.nic.in
